Common bindings include book-style bindings, ring binders, tape binding, lay-flat bindings, wire spiral, and sewn bindings across the available notebooks and planners.

Layouts include lined/ruled pages, quad-ruled graph pages, narrow and wide rulings, blank pages, and guided formats; some planners also include dedicated meeting-note pages or starter sheets designed for meetings.

Features include pockets, dividers, pen holders, ribbon bookmarks, elastic closures, and phone or card pockets; some planners also include starter sheets with meeting-note, calendar, and to-do sections.

Some notebooks list 120 g/m² paper weight; reviewers also commonly note thick, smooth pages with generally low ink bleed, indicating heavier, better-performing paper in several options.

Many options are described as compact, travel-friendly, or purse-sized. Some listings reference A5-format or similarly compact planners (an example dimension given in some descriptions is about 9.5 x 7.5 x 1.5 inches) and smaller journals that fit in a backpack or purse. Check the specific product dimensions on the listing to confirm fit for your bag.

Ease-of-use features include lay-flat binding, perforated pages for neat removal, ribbon bookmarks/page markers, elastic closures, and three-hole punching for inserting pages into binders.
